    Don't get out of your truck after dark, of course lock the doors, dont get out of the sleeper, cause someone who may knock on your door may have a gun pointed at you through the window, can buy a two inch strap & ratchet cheaply, and on the old freightliner doors if you wanted wrap the strap by the handle to close door and ratchet it shut. NOT to tight, not going for a test of strength here, secure these stupid hatches they put on sleepers, people was prying them open while you slept and spraying like ether in there with you and making you go into deep sleep, and unable to wake while they rob you.. Or best bet just stay outside the city limit til daybreak and don't park in such a place, if you see bars on barbershops, and all businesses, its usually a good sign you're not in a perfect neighborhood.

    Don't make eye contact with people or engage them...some areas I went to that had heavy truck traffic there always seemed to be the guy that would help "direct" you or clean out the trailer. That Kroger DC on I think the southeast side of Atlanta by the Pilot is the worst place...guys on the street in yellow vest and a flashlight acting like they are there to help. Would suck if you sprayed someone with wasp spray and got yourself. I always figured that if someone tried to get in the truck that they wouldn't be familiar with how to climb in and while they are trying I would be pounding their skull with a tire bat or better yet the tandem pin puller.

    Dont go to them. I have my wife with me so it is a bit different for me. I have told dispatch she rides with me I will not stay in Downtown Philly, NY, and no way in hell will I go to Detroit. We only stay in West Memphis at our terminal.

    Stay with other trucks. Safety in numbers. If they want the load give it to them. We were told to put up fight but not going tto lose my lofe over stuff that can be replaced.
